+/* Although we don't need to load anything for a local path (we just return
+ * the path from the file:// URL), the other load helpers will error-out on
+ * non-existant files. So, do the same here with an access() check on the local
+ * filename.
+ */
+static void load_local(struct load_task *task)
+{
+       int rc;
+
+       rc = access(task->url->path, F_OK);
+       if (rc) {
+               task->result->status = LOAD_ERROR;
+       } else {
+               task->result->local = talloc_strdup(task->result,
+                                                   task->url->path);
+               task->result->status = LOAD_OK;
+       }
+}
